SUNROOF/HEADLINING

Noises in the sunroof/headlining area can often be traced to one of the following

  1. Sunroof lid, rail, linkage or seals making a rattle or light knocking noise
  2. Sun-visor shaft shaking in the holder
  3. Front or rear windshield touching headlining and squeaking Again, pressing on the components to stop the noise while duplicating the conditions can isolate most of these incidents. Repairs usually consist of insulating with felt cloth tape.

When isolating seat noise it's important to note the position the seat is in and the load placed on the seat when the noise is present. These conditions should be duplicated when verifying and isolating the cause of the noise.

Cause of seat noise include

  1. Headrest rods and holder
  2. A squeak between the seat pad cushion and frame
  3. The rear seatback lock and bracket These noises can be isolated by moving or pressing on the suspected components while duplicating the conditions under which the noise occurs. Most of these incidents can be repaired by repositioning the component or applying urethane tape to the contact area.
